44////////////////////
45// Inline methods
46////////////////////
47
48inline
49G4double G4PhysicsOrderedFreeVector::GetMaxValue()
50{
51 return dataVector.back();
52}
53
54inline
55G4double G4PhysicsOrderedFreeVector::GetMinValue()
56{
57 return dataVector.front();
58}
59
60inline
61G4double G4PhysicsOrderedFreeVector::GetMaxLowEdgeEnergy()
62{
63 return binVector.back();
64}
65
66inline
67G4double G4PhysicsOrderedFreeVector::GetMinLowEdgeEnergy()
68{
69 return binVector.front();
70}
71
72inline
73void G4PhysicsOrderedFreeVector::DumpValues()
74{
75 for (size_t i = 0; i < numberOfNodes; i++)
76 {
77 G4cout << binVector[i] << "\t" << dataVector[i] << G4endl;
78 }
79}
80
81inline
82size_t G4PhysicsOrderedFreeVector::FindBinLocation(G4double theEnergy) const
83{
84 G4int n1 = 0;
85 G4int n2 = numberOfNodes/2;
86 G4int n3 = numberOfNodes - 1;
87 while (n1 != n3 - 1)
88 {
89 if (theEnergy > binVector[n2])
90 { n1 = n2; }
91 else
92 { n3 = n2; }
93 n2 = n1 + (n3 - n1 + 1)/2;
94 }
95 return (size_t)n1;
96}
